Everton's chances of sealing deal for Leicester City player become clearer

Article image:Everton's chances of sealing deal for Leicester City player become clearer

Everton are unlikely to sign Leicester City attacker Kasey McAteer in the January transfer window.

That's according to a report from The Daily Mail (31/12, p34), who say that the Toffees will be dictated by their budget when it comes to the business they do next month.

McAteer breaking out at Leicester this season

Having come through the youth ranks at Leicester, McAteer had made just a handful of first-team appearances for the club prior to this season, while spending time out on loan with AFC Wimbledon and Forest Green.

This season though, has seen the 22-year-old become an important figure for the Foxes, as they chase an immediate promotion from the Championship back to the Premier League.

Since the start of the current campaign, McAteer has made 14 appearances in all competitions for Leicester, scoring five goals in that time.

The attacker has also been hampered by injuries this season, but has still managed to attract attention from elsewhere.

According to previous reports from Football Transfers, Everton are plotting a move to sign the 22-year-old in the January transfer window.

Now however, it seems as though it is far from certain that such a deal will happen once the window reopens at the turn of the year.

this latest update from the Daily Mail, looking at each Premier League club's January targets, McAteer is admired by Everton.

the report states that there is only a "slim chance" that a move to bring the 22-year-old to Goodison Park next month.

It is claimed that budget issues will influence the business done by the Toffees in January. Everton have already been deducted ten points this season, over previous breaches of Profit and Sustainability rules.

As things stand, there are around 18 months remaining on McAteer's contract with the Foxes, securing his future at The King Power Stadium until the end of the 2024/25 season.

That means that Leicester are not under pressure to sell the winger in the January market, if they do not wish to do so.

Leicester pushing for immediate Premier League return

It has been an excellent first season back in the Championship for Leicester, following their relegation at the end of the previous campaign.

The Foxes have claimed 62 points from 25 league games so far, meaning they currently sit top of the table, 11 points clear of the play-off places.

Enzo Maresca's side are next in action on New Year's Day, when they host Huddersfield Town at The New York Stadium.
